Big Hit Entertainment and Universal Music Group make a partnership as they plan to launch a new international boy group!

On February 18, Thursday, Big Hit Entertainment and Universal Music Group joined forces to launch a new global boy group and recently made a joint announcement to discuss their strategic partnership. The two giants have started sharing the same vision as they started making VenewLive a streaming platform that Big Hit uses for virtual concerts a global platform for everyone to access.

In the video, both the Big Hit Entertainment and Universal Music Group CEOs Bang Si Hyuk, Lucian Grainge, and Lenzo Yoon have announced that they will be launching a 'global artist debut project' commenced through an audition program. Lenzo Yoon stated that the companies would be debuting a new boy group whose activities will focus mainly on international activities, and the global audition will be aired live with a U.S. media partner next year.

Moreover, Big Hit Entertainment will be in charge of extensively training the potential members, while the Universal Music Group will be executing the audition program in partnership with American media partners.

"In this project, Big Hit Entertainment will be in charge of discovering and training artists, fan content production, and communication with fans through Weverse. Making use of their powerful local network, Universal Music Group will be in charge of music production, global distribution, and producing the audition program with U.S. media partners." - Lenzo Yoon
